Abstract

본 발명은 콘크리트수조의 배관파이프 설치구조에 관한 것으로서, 콘크리트수조(100)를 형성하고 있는 벽(110)과 폴리에틸렌시트(200)를 관통하도록 배관파이프(310)가 설치되는 것에 있어서, 상기 배관파이프(310)가 폴리에틸렌시트(200)에 외주면이 열융착되면서 방수가 이루어지도록 폴리에틸렌시트(200)와 동일한 재질로 제작되어 설치됨으로서, 상기 배관파이프(310)가 설치되어 있는 배관부(300) 주위로 누수가 발생하거나 콘크리트수조(100)의 외부에서 발생된 오염물질이 내부로 유입되는 것이 미연에 방지되도록 배관파이프(310)를 설치하는 것이 용이하게 이루어지게 됨은 물론, 상기 배관파이프(310)가 방수기능을 갖도록 설치시 작업공정이 저감되어 작업성이 향상되도록 하는 것이다.The present invention relates to a pipe installation structure of the concrete tank, the pipe pipe 310 is installed so as to pass through the wall 110 and the polyethylene sheet 200 forming the concrete tank 100, the pipe pipe The 310 is manufactured and installed in the same material as the polyethylene sheet 200 so that the outer circumferential surface of the polyethylene sheet 200 is heat-sealed to achieve waterproofing, so that the piping pipe 310 is installed around the piping 300. Of course, it is easy to install the pipe pipe 310 to prevent leakage or inflow of pollutants generated from the outside of the concrete water tank 100 into the inside, and the pipe pipe 310 is waterproof. The installation process is reduced to have a function to improve workability.

일반적으로 저수조(貯水曹)는 일정량의 물을 저장하여 주거용 아파트 및 업무용 빌딩등과 같이 생활용수의 사용이 많은 건축물에 공급할 수 있도록 하는 것으로, 이러한 저수조는 스테인리스패널수조, SMC수조, FRP수조, PDF수조, 콘크리트수조 등과 같이 사용되는 재질에 따라 그 종류가 구분 된다.In general, a reservoir is a water tank that stores a certain amount of water so that it can be supplied to buildings that use a lot of water, such as residential apartments and business buildings.These tanks are stainless steel panel tanks, SMC tanks, FRP tanks, PDFs. Types are classified according to the materials used, such as tanks and concrete tanks.

이러한 저수조에 있어서, 상기 콘크리트수조의 경우에는 내부에 담겨있는 물이 외부로 누수되는 것을 방지하기 위하여 콘크리트 구조물의 시공을 완료한 후 내벽에 방수액을 2회이상 도포하게 되는데, 이러한 방수작업은 사방이 밀폐된 콘크리트저수조의 내부에서 이루어지게 됨으로서 작업자가 냄새등에 의해 작업을 수행시 불편함을 느끼게 되는 문제점이 있었다.In such a water tank, in the case of the concrete water tank, after the construction of the concrete structure is completed in order to prevent the water contained in the inside from leaking to the outside, the waterproofing solution is applied to the inner wall two or more times. By being made in the interior of the concrete reservoir, there was a problem that the worker feels uncomfortable when performing the work by smell.

한편, 상기와 같이 방수액이 도포되어 형성된 방수층이 일정 기간이 경과하여 손상이 발생하면, 상기 손상된 방수층의 위에 에폭시 페인트를 도장하여 방수 기능을 수행하도록 수질이 보호되도록 하고 있다.On the other hand, if a damage occurs after a certain period of time the waterproof layer is formed by applying the waterproofing liquid, the water quality is protected so as to perform the waterproof function by coating the epoxy paint on the damaged waterproof layer.

그러나 이러한 에폭시 페인트는 휘발성이 강한 수지로 조성되어 있어 그 유해성분으로 인해 작업중 호흡곤란을 유발시키고, 심한 경우에는 질식사를 유발시키게 되는 문제점이 있었다.However, these epoxy paints are composed of a highly volatile resin, causing harmful breathing during the operation due to its harmful components, and in severe cases, there is a problem of causing asphyxiation.

또한, 이러한 에폭시 페인트는 도막 부착력의 한계 때문에 단 기간 내에 내벽의 표면으로부터 이탈하는 박리현상이 발생하여 수질을 오염시키게 되는 결함이 있어 2~3년에 한번씩 재 도장작업을 하여야 하는 비 경제적인 문제점이 있었다.In addition, the epoxy paint has a defect that causes peeling from the surface of the inner wall within a short period of time due to the limitation of the adhesion of the coating film, and contaminates the water quality. there was.

한편, 상기 에폭시 페인트는 인체에 아주 유해한 환경호르몬인 비스페놀A가함유되어 있어, 이러한 유해물질이 저수조에 담겨있는 물에 함유된 상태로 공급되어 인체에 소량이라도 축적되는 경우에는 건강에 악영향을 미치게 되는 문제점이 있었다.On the other hand, the epoxy paint contains bisphenol A, an environmental hormone that is very harmful to the human body, and when such a harmful substance is supplied in the state contained in the water tank and accumulates even in small amounts in the human body, it adversely affects health. There was a problem.

따라서 종래에도 상기와 같은 문제점을 해결하기 위해 도 1에 도시하고 있는 같이 콘크리트수조(100)의 내측 벽면에 폴리에틸렌시트(Polyethylene Sheet)(200)를 고정되게 설치하여 방수가 이루어지도록 하고 있다.Therefore, in order to solve the problems as described above, the polyethylene sheet 200 is fixedly installed on the inner wall surface of the concrete water tank 100 as shown in FIG.

그러나 상기 콘크리트수조(100)를 형성하고 있는 벽(110)과 폴리에틸렌시트(200)를 관통하도록 배관파이프(310)를 설치하는 경우, 상기 배관파이프(310)가 설치되어 있는 배관부(300) 주위로 누수가 발생하거나 콘크리트수조(100)의 외부에서 발생된 오염물질이 내부로 유입되어 수질을 오염시키게 되는 문제점이 있었다.However, when the pipe pipe 310 is installed to penetrate the wall 110 and the polyethylene sheet 200 forming the concrete water tank 100, the pipe 300 is installed around the pipe part 300. There is a problem in that water leakage or contaminants generated from the outside of the concrete water tank 100 is introduced into the inside to contaminate the water quality.

따라서 종래에는 상기 콘크리트수조(100)의 내부에 위치하고 있는 배관파이프(310)의 외측면을 감싸도록 실링재(320)를 설치하고, 상기 실링재(320)의 외측면에는 폴리에틸렌시트(200)와 같은 재질로 제작된 폴리에틸렌판넬(330)을 밴드(340)를 이용해 감싸도록 설치하며, 상기, 밴드(340)에 의해 실링재(320)의 외측면을 감싸고 있는 폴리에틸렌판넬(330)을 폴리에틸렌시트(200)에 열융착시켜 배관부(300) 주위가 방수되도록 하고 있다.Therefore, in the related art, a sealing material 320 is installed to surround the outer surface of the pipe pipe 310 located inside the concrete water tank 100, and the same material as the polyethylene sheet 200 is provided on the outer surface of the sealing material 320. The polyethylene panel 330 is manufactured to be wrapped using the band 340, and the polyethylene panel 330 surrounding the outer surface of the sealing material 320 by the band 340 is disposed on the polyethylene sheet 200. By heat fusion, the periphery of the pipe part 300 is waterproof.

그러나 이 역시도 상기 배관파이프(310)의 외측면을 실링재(320)가 감싸도록 밴드(340)를 이용해 폴리에틸렌판넬(330)을 설치하여야 함은 물론, 상기 실링재(320)를 감싸고 있는 폴리에틸렌판넬(330)의 단부를 폴리에틸렌시트(200)에열융착시켜야 함으로서, 콘크리트수조(100)에 배관부(300)를 설치시, 작업성이 증가하여 작업성을 저하시키게 됨은 물론, 상기 배관파이프(310)와 폴리에틸렌판넬(330)간에 틈새가 발생하는 경우에는 제대로 방수가 이루어지지 않아 상기 배관파이프(310)가 설치되어 있는 배관부(300) 주위로 누수가 발생하거나 콘크리트수조(100)의 외부에서 발생된 오염물질이 내부로 유입되어 수질을 오염시키게 되는 문제점이 있었다.However, this also needs to install the polyethylene panel 330 using the band 340 to surround the outer surface of the pipe pipe 310, the sealing material 320, as well as the polyethylene panel 330 surrounding the sealing material 320 By heat-sealing the end of the) to the polyethylene sheet 200, when installing the pipe portion 300 in the concrete water tank 100, the workability is increased to lower the workability, as well as the pipe pipe 310 and polyethylene If a gap is generated between the panels 330, water is not properly waterproofed so that water leaks around the pipe part 300 in which the pipe pipe 310 is installed, or pollutants generated outside the concrete water tank 100. There was a problem that is introduced into the inside to pollute the water quality.

본 발명의 목적은 상기 종래와 같은 문제점을 해결하기 위해, 콘크리트수조를 형성하고 있는 벽과 폴리에틸렌시트를 관통하도록 배관파이프가 설치되는 것에 있어서, 상기 배관파이프가 폴리에틸렌시트에 외주면이 열융착되면서 방수가 이루어지도록 폴리에틸렌시트와 동일한 재질로 제작되어 설치됨으로서, 상기 배관파이프가 설치되어 있는 배관부 주위로 누수가 발생하거나 콘크리트수조의 외부에서 발생된 오염물질이 내부로 유입되는 것이 미연에 방지되도록 배관파이프를 설치하는 것이 용이하게 이루어지게 됨은 물론, 상기 배관파이프가 방수기능을 갖도록 설치시 작업공정이 저감되어 작업성이 향상되도록 하는 콘크리트수조의 배관파이프 설치구조를 제공하는 데 있다.An object of the present invention, in order to solve the problems as described above, in the pipe pipe is installed so as to penetrate the polyethylene sheet and the wall forming the concrete tank, the pipe is waterproof while the outer peripheral surface is heat-sealed on the polyethylene sheet Since the pipe is made of the same material as the polyethylene sheet and installed, the pipe pipe is prevented from leaking around the pipe part where the pipe pipe is installed or the inflow of contaminants generated from the outside of the concrete tank. In addition, it is easy to install, of course, to provide a pipe pipe installation structure of the concrete water tank to reduce the work process when the installation work so that the pipe is waterproof to improve the workability.

이하 첨부된 도면에 의하여 본 발명의 그 기술적 구성을 상세히 설명하면 다음과 같다.Hereinafter, the technical configuration of the present invention with reference to the accompanying drawings in detail.

본 발명의 콘크리트수조의 배관파이프 설치구조도 도 2에 도시하고 있는 바와 같이, 콘크리트수조(100)를 형성하고 있는 벽(110)과 폴리에틸렌시트(200)를 관통하도록 배관파이프(310)가 설치되는 것은 종래와 같다. 단, 본 발명은 상기 콘크리트수조(100)의 벽(110)을 관통하는 배관파이프(310)가 폴리에틸렌시트(200)와 동일한 폴리에틸렌 재질로 제작되어 설치되고, 상기 배관파이프(310)의 외주면은 폴리에틸렌시트(200)와 열융착(400) 됨을 그 기술적 구성상의 기본 특징으로 한다.As shown in FIG. 2, the pipe pipe installation structure of the concrete water tank according to the present invention includes a pipe pipe 310 installed to penetrate the wall 110 and the polyethylene sheet 200 forming the concrete water tank 100. It is the same as before. However, in the present invention, the pipe pipe 310 penetrating the wall 110 of the concrete tank 100 is made of the same polyethylene material as the polyethylene sheet 200 and is installed, and the outer peripheral surface of the pipe pipe 310 is polyethylene The sheet 200 and the thermal fusion 400 is a basic feature of the technical configuration.

이와같이 구성되는 본 발명은 콘크리트수조(100)에 배관부(300)를 설치시, 폴리에틸렌시트(200)와 동일한 재질로 제작된 배관파이프(310)를 콘크리트수조(100)의 벽(110)과 폴리에틸렌시트(200)를 관통하도록 설치하고, 상기 폴리에틸렌시트(200)와 벽(110)을 관통하도록 설치된 배관파이프(310)의 외측부를 폴리에틸렌시트(200)에 열융착시키는 것에 의해, 상기 콘크리트수조(100)에 담겨져 있는 물이 배관파이프(310)가 설치되어 있는 배관부(300)를 통해 외부로 누출되지 않게 된다.In the present invention configured as described above, when the pipe 300 is installed in the concrete tank 100, the pipe pipe 310 made of the same material as the polyethylene sheet 200, the wall 110 and the polyethylene of the concrete tank 100 The concrete water tank 100 is installed by penetrating the sheet 200 and heat-sealing the outer portion of the pipe pipe 310 installed to penetrate the polyethylene sheet 200 and the wall 110 to the polyethylene sheet 200. The water contained in the) is not leaked to the outside through the pipe portion 300 is installed pipe pipe 310 is installed.

따라서 이러한 본 발명은 콘크리트수조(100)에 배관부(300)를 설치시, 상기 콘크리트수조(100)의 벽(110)과 상기 벽(110)에 일측면이 접하며 고정되게 설치되어 있는 폴리에틸린시트(200)를 관통하도록 폴리에틸렌으로 제작된 배관파이프(310)를 설치한 후 상기 배관파이프를 폴리에틸렌시트(200)와 열융착(400) 시켜 주는 것에 의해 방수가 이루어지게 됨으로서, 상기 배관파이프(310)가 설치되어 있는 배관부(300) 주위로 누수가 발생하거나 콘크리트수조(100)의 외부에서 발생된 오염물질이 내부로 유입되는 것이 미연에 방지되도록 배관파이프(310)를 설치하는 것이 용이하게 이루어지게 됨은 물론, 상기 배관파이프(310)가 방수기능을 갖도록 설치시 작업공정이 저감되어 작업성이 향상되도록 하는 효과가 있다.Therefore, the present invention, when installing the pipe portion 300 in the concrete tank 100, the side of the wall 110 and the wall 110 of the concrete tank 100 is fixed in contact with the polyethylen is installed After installing the pipe pipe 310 made of polyethylene so as to penetrate the sheet 200, the water pipe is made by heat-sealing (400) the polyethylene pipe 200, the pipe pipe 310 It is easy to install the piping pipe 310 so that water leakage around the pipe portion 300 is installed or the pollutants generated from the outside of the concrete water tank 100 is prevented from entering the inside in advance. Of course, there is an effect that the work process is reduced during installation so that the pipe pipe 310 has a waterproof function to improve workability.
